Art Center College of Design vs. Casa Loma College-Los Angeles

Both Art Center College of Design and Casa Loma College-Los Angeles are Private, 4 years schools located in California. The following statements compare Art Center College of Design and Casa Loma College-Los Angeles with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Art Center College of Design's tuition ($54,170) is more expensive than Casa Loma College-Los Angeles ($43,648).
  • Casa Loma College-Los Angeles's acceptance rate (42.55%) is lower than Art Center College of Design (74.54%).
  • Casa Loma College-Los Angeles has higher yield (100.00%) than Art Center College of Design (31.50%).
  • Art Center College of Design's students to faculty ratio (9 to 1) is lower than Casa Loma College-Los Angeles (19 to 1).
  • Art Center College of Design (2,308 students) is larger than Casa Loma College-Los Angeles (759 students) with more enrolled students.
  • Art Center College of Design ($18,895) has higher amount of financial aid than Casa Loma College-Los Angeles ($5,998).
  • Art Center College of Design's graduation rate (79%) is higher than Casa Loma College-Los Angeles (73%).
